コード例 #1
0
ファイル: InputService.cs プロジェクト: HuynhEmCuong/Bottom
 public InputService(
     IPackingListRepository repoPackingList,
     IQRCodeMainRepository repoQRCodeMain,
     IQRCodeDetailRepository repoQRCodeDetail,
     ITransactionMainRepo repoTransactionMain,
     ITransactionDetailRepo repoTransactionDetail,
     IMaterialMissingRepository repoMaterialMissing,
     IMaterialPurchaseRepository repoMatPurchase,
     IMaterialMissingRepository repoMatMissing,
     IMaterialViewRepository repoMaterialView,
     IRackLocationRepo repoRacklocationRepo,
     IPackingListDetailRepository repoPacKingListDetail,
     IDatabaseConnectionFactory database,
     IMapper mapper, 
     MapperConfiguration configMapper)
 {
     _configMapper = configMapper;
     _mapper = mapper;
     _repoQRCodeMain = repoQRCodeMain;
     _repoQRCodeDetail = repoQRCodeDetail;
     _repoPackingList = repoPackingList;
     _repoTransactionMain = repoTransactionMain;
     _repoTransactionDetail = repoTransactionDetail;
     _repoMaterialMissing = repoMaterialMissing;
     _repoMatMissing = repoMatMissing;
     _repoMatPurchase = repoMatPurchase;
     _repoMaterialView = repoMaterialView;
     _repoRacklocationRepo = repoRacklocationRepo;
     _repoPacKingListDetail = repoPacKingListDetail;
     _database = database;
 }
コード例 #2
0
ファイル: OutputService.cs プロジェクト: HuynhEmCuong/Bottom
 public OutputService(
     IPackingListRepository repoPackingList,
     IQRCodeMainRepository repoQRCodeMain,
     IQRCodeDetailRepository repoQRCodeDetail,
     ITransactionMainRepo repoTransactionMain,
     ITransactionDetailRepo repoTransactionDetail,
     IMaterialSheetSizeRepository repoMaterialSheetSize,
     IRackLocationRepo repoRackLocation,
     ICodeIDDetailRepo repoCode,
     IMapper mapper, MapperConfiguration configMapper,
     IMaterialViewRepository repoMaterialView,
     IPackingListDetailRepository repoPackingListDetail,
     ITransferFormRepository repoTransferForm)
 {
     _configMapper          = configMapper;
     _mapper                = mapper;
     _repoQRCodeMain        = repoQRCodeMain;
     _repoQRCodeDetail      = repoQRCodeDetail;
     _repoPackingList       = repoPackingList;
     _repoTransactionMain   = repoTransactionMain;
     _repoTransactionDetail = repoTransactionDetail;
     _repoMaterialSheetSize = repoMaterialSheetSize;
     _repoRackLocation      = repoRackLocation;
     _repoCode              = repoCode;
     _repoMaterialView      = repoMaterialView;
     _repoPackingListDetail = repoPackingListDetail;
     _repoTransferForm      = repoTransferForm;
 }
コード例 #3
0
 public QRCodeMainService(IQRCodeMainRepository repoQrcode,
                          IPackingListRepository repoPacking,
                          IPackingListDetailRepository repoPackingDetail,
                          IQRCodeDetailRepository repoQrCodeDetail,
                          IMapper mapper,
                          ITransactionDetailRepo repoTransactionDetail,
                          ITransactionMainRepo repoTransactionMain)
 {
     _repoQrcode            = repoQrcode;
     _repoPacking           = repoPacking;
     _repoPackingDetail     = repoPackingDetail;
     _repoQrCodeDetail      = repoQrCodeDetail;
     _mapper                = mapper;
     _repoTransactionDetail = repoTransactionDetail;
     _repoTransactionMain   = repoTransactionMain;
 }
コード例 #4
0
 public TransferLocationService(
     ITransactionMainRepo repoTransactionMain,
     ITransactionDetailRepo repoTransactionDetail,
     IQRCodeMainRepository repoQRCodeMain,
     IMapper mapper,
     MapperConfiguration configMapper,
     IPackingListRepository repoPackingList,
     IMaterialViewRepository repoMaterialView)
 {
     _configMapper          = configMapper;
     _repoPackingList       = repoPackingList;
     _mapper                = mapper;
     _repoTransactionMain   = repoTransactionMain;
     _repoTransactionDetail = repoTransactionDetail;
     _repoQRCodeMain        = repoQRCodeMain;
     _repoMaterialView      = repoMaterialView;
 }
コード例 #5
0
 public PackingListDetailService(IPackingListDetailRepository repoPackingListDetail,
                                 IPackingListRepository repoPackingList,
                                 IQRCodeMainRepository repoQrcode,
                                 IMaterialPurchaseRepository repoMaterialPurchase,
                                 ITransactionMainRepo repoTransactionMain,
                                 ITransactionDetailRepo repoTransactionDetail,
                                 IMapper mapper,
                                 MapperConfiguration configMapper)
 {
     _repoPackingListDetail = repoPackingListDetail;
     _repoPackingList       = repoPackingList;
     _repoMaterialPurchase  = repoMaterialPurchase;
     _repoQrcode            = repoQrcode;
     _repoTransactionMain   = repoTransactionMain;
     _repoTransactionDetail = repoTransactionDetail;
     _mapper       = mapper;
     _configMapper = configMapper;
 }
コード例 #6
0
ファイル: InputService.cs プロジェクト: SD-Team/WH_Bottom
 public InputService(
     IPackingListRepository repoPackingList,
     IQRCodeMainRepository repoQRCodeMain,
     IQRCodeDetailRepository repoQRCodeDetail,
     ITransactionMainRepo repoTransactionMain,
     ITransactionDetailRepo repoTransactionDetail,
     IMaterialMissingRepository repoMaterialMissing,
     IMaterialPurchaseRepository repoMatPurchase,
     IMaterialMissingRepository repoMatMissing,
     IMaterialViewRepository repoMaterialView,
     IMapper mapper, MapperConfiguration configMapper)
 {
     _configMapper          = configMapper;
     _mapper                = mapper;
     _repoQRCodeMain        = repoQRCodeMain;
     _repoQRCodeDetail      = repoQRCodeDetail;
     _repoPackingList       = repoPackingList;
     _repoTransactionMain   = repoTransactionMain;
     _repoTransactionDetail = repoTransactionDetail;
     _repoMaterialMissing   = repoMaterialMissing;
     _repoMatMissing        = repoMatMissing;
     _repoMatPurchase       = repoMatPurchase;
     _repoMaterialView      = repoMaterialView;
 }
コード例 #7
0
 public TransferFormService(ITransactionMainRepo transactionMainRepo,
                            IPackingListRepository packingListRepository,
                            IQRCodeMainRepository qRCodeMainRepository,
                            IPackingListDetailRepository packingListDetailRepository,
                            ITransferFormRepository transferFormRepository,
                            IMaterialViewRepository materialViewRepository,
                            ITransactionDetailRepo transactionDetailRepo,
                            IMaterialPurchaseRepository materialPurchaseRepository,
                            ISettingSupplierRepository settingSupplierRepository,
                            ICacheRepository cacheRepository,
                            IMailUtility iMailUtility)
 {
     _transactionMainRepo         = transactionMainRepo;
     _packingListRepository       = packingListRepository;
     _packingListDetailRepository = packingListDetailRepository;
     _transferFormRepository      = transferFormRepository;
     _materialViewRepository      = materialViewRepository;
     _transactionDetailRepo       = transactionDetailRepo;
     _materialPurchaseRepository  = materialPurchaseRepository;
     _settingSupplierRepository   = settingSupplierRepository;
     _qRCodeMainRepository        = qRCodeMainRepository;
     _iMailUtility    = iMailUtility;
     _cacheRepository = cacheRepository;
 }